Geraldine learns the heavy price to be paid for Christian kindness in the 1996 seasonal special. Guest-starring Peter Capaldi and Mel Giedroyc.
Writers Paul Mayhew Archer and Richard Curtis ; Director
Gareth Carrivick ; Producers Jon Plowman and Sue Vertue

Gary Lineker , Mark Lawrenson and Alan Hansen present highlights from today's Premiership matches, including the London derby between Tottenham and Fulham, and Newcastle's battle with West Ham. Match of the Day 2 is tomorrow at 10.15pm on BBC2. Producer Phil Bigwood ; Editor Paul Armstrong
Repeated tomorrow at 7.55am

Highlights from the first day of the intercontinental challenge held in Athens, including the men's 100m featuring recently crowned European champion Francis Obikwelu for Team Europe, and the women's 800m with Britain's Becky Lyne. Commentary from Steve Cram , Stuart Storey , Paul Dickenson and Jonathan Edwards. Producers Jim Bentley and Ronald Mcintosh

Frantic adventure starring Christopher George and Yvette Mimieux. Globetrotter Morgan finds himself framed for robbery and thrust into espionage when the CIA partners him with female agent Kim Stacy. Review page 49.
Director Tay Garnett (1970)

About BBC One

BBC One is a TV channel that started broadcasting on the 20th April 1964. It replaced BBC Television.
